HOME SEPARATION.

WAIKATO EXPERIENCE. (Per Press Association.) Hamilton, March IS. ( The Waikato Co-operative Dairy Company, which goes in for the home separation process, estimates its output this year at 700 tons, with the prospect of a thousand tons next year. It has only been operating for three years, and is the second largest butter producing concern in tho Auckland province. The company is regarded a.s tho salvation of the small dairy farmer in isolated districts.
